September 13, 2024 CITY OF ROCKDALE PLANNING AND ZONING COMMISSION MEETING Present: P&Z Commissioners: City Staff: Doug Williams, Chair Timothy Kelty, City Manager Leslie Davidson Barbara Holly, AICP, City Manager Charles Miles Ben Blanchard, City Planner Jason Barcak Shanna Johnson, City Secretary Absent: Joan Ratliff, Vice Chair Daniel Willie Scott Starnes, Council Liaison Call to order and announce a Quorum is Present With a quorum present, the Planning and Zoning Commission Meeting was called to order by Chair Williams at 1:39 p.m. on Tuesday, September 13, 2024, at Rockdale City Hall, 505 West Cameron Avenue, Rockdale, Texas. Citizen Communications • Evelyn Little – addressed the commission about road repairs to O’Kelley Street and would like to see a hospital in Rockdale. • Jeannette Behrens (110 S. Travis Street) – addressed the commission about the need for the city to maintain the right-of-way along Travis Street to prevent the growth of high grass and weeds. 4A. Receive a presentation from Chair Williams on the City Council meeting. Chair Williams reported that the council will revisit the mobile food vendor ordinance to discuss an improved parking surface. Council authorized the city manager to negotiate with Empire Sign Company to approve the sign variance and request a monument sign instead of a pole sign for the new Dollar Tree store. City Manager Kelty discussed that the Council is currently reviewing what surface to use along O’Kelley. 5A. Consider and take any necessary action on a recommendation to the City Council regarding a preliminary plat submitted by Philip Bargas for property located in the 600 Block of Texas Street also known as Property ID: 15190, Rockdale, Milam County, Texas into two blocks and 24 lots. MOTION: Upon a motion made by Commissioner Miles and a second by Commissioner Barcak, the Commission voted four (4) for and none (0) opposed to approve the preliminary plat subject to staff comments. Motion Carried. 5B. Consider and take any necessary action on a recommendation to the City Council regarding a preliminary plat submitted by Philip Bargas for property located in the 700 Block of Texas Street also known as Property ID: 20077 and 23877, Rockdale, Milam County, Texas into five blocks and 214 lots. MOTION: Upon a motion made by Commissioner Barcak and a second by Commissioner Miles, the Commission voted four (4) for and none (0) opposed to approve the plat subject to staff comments which include updating the setback lines and notating the back property lines. Motion Carried. 5C. Consider and take any necessary action on a recommendation to city council regarding an amendment to the parking on improved surface parking ordinance. Jeanette Behrens – Had questions on the grandfather clause portion. Also expressed that her surrounding community has no improved driveways. John Rush – Expressed that if dirt in the streets can be addressed by a street sweeper. Has expressed that the ordinance should be rescinded. Denny Dunkel (721 Hunter) – Asked for clarification on where the ordinance stood at the time of the meeting. Mr. Dunkel expressed that the ordinance should be rescinded and that he is opposed to the current existing ordinance to economic hardship. Susan Howell (1119 Alcoa) – Had questions on if an environmental impact study was done before adoption, the trailer portion of the existing ordinance, and how Samsungs development will affect future ordinances. MOTION: Upon a motion made by Commissioner Miles and a second by Commissioner Barcak, the Commission voted three (3) for and one (1) opposed to approve the ordinance with the amendments and send to council for review; amendments include removing the parking on street violation, removing the portion that allows for the towing of vehicles, provides additional improved surfaces for parking, and defines and provides legal non-conformance for existing properties. Voting opposed Commissioner Davidson. Motion Carried. 5D. Consider and take any necessary action on a recommendation to city council regarding an amendment regarding the mobile food vendor ordinance. MOTION: Upon a motion made by Commissioner Barcak and a second by Commissioner Miles, the Commission voted four (4) for and none (0) opposed to approve the amendments regarding the improved surface requirements and protective measures used between the unit and vehicle to send to council for review. Motion Carried. 5E. Consider and take any necessary action on a recommendation to city council regarding an amendment regarding outside storage ordinance. MOTION: Upon a motion made by Commissioner Barcak and a second by Commissioner Miles, the Commission voted four (4) for and none (0) opposed to approve amendments and send to council for review. Motion Carried. Commissioner Davidson resigns from the board. Adjourned at 3:13 p.m. These minutes approved on the 1st day of October 2024.
